The bikes of Shinya Kimura

I’m a big fan of Shinya Kimura’s work. His motorcycles are built from his heart and his soul and not what the current trends are. His bikes are built free for the limitations of what bikes are supposed to be. He rarely draws his ideas on paper, leaving him to discover the bikes through the feeling of the materials rather than planning them out start to finish. Shinya currently builds under the shop name Chabott Engineering, located in Azusa California. This great video about Shinya Kimura was filmed by Henrik Hansen.

Victor Bike by Christophe Robillard

The Victor bike by Christophe Robillard is as unusual as they come. It’s a minimalist’s dream on 2 wheels. Robillard removed all the material he could from the bike by using a tube bending process that left him with a skeleton structure of a frame. The benefit, other that the bike looks really cool, is that all the costs of building a traditional frame are cut in half. The amount of metal forming required is drastically cut as is the number of welds that are traditionally done by hand.

The bike features an integrated rear wheel fender and reflectors on both the front and back. My only concern with the frame is that the back wheel may wobble with the flexing of the frame, something I’m sure he has taken into account.

Scrapertown by California is a Place

There is an awesome movement on 2 wheels going on in Oakland California right now, Scraper Bikes, lead by CHAMP the king of the Original Scraper Bike Team. It seems like this movement is being driven by a passion to keep kids on the straight and narrow and o give them something to focus their creativity on. CHAMP seems to care not only about being fly, but inspiring others to get in touch with their creativity as a positive outlet for dealing with life in Oakland.

The video was done by California is a Place.

About Scraperism from The Scraper Bike King:

The scraper bike movement seeks to capture the creativity of youth within dangerous communities and give them a positive outlet thats fun, educational, and promotes healthy lifestyles. It gives youth a sustainable group of peers thats positive and motivating. We want to expand and enlighten young peoples perspective on life through fixing and painting bicycles, also by supporting entrepreneurship and innovation.

In order to become a member of the Original Scraper Bike Team, you must: Be a resident of Oakland, CA. Be at least 7y/o or older. Retain A 3.0 Grade Point Average (GPA), Create your own Scraper Bike…(It Has To Be Amazing, Or Else You Can’t Ride.) A single-file line when riding. After 10 rides The Scraper Bike King and his Captains will decide if your bike is up to standards and if you can follow simple guidelines. — The Scraper Bike King
